Sčítání provádíme běžným způsobem. Pouze si musíme uvědomit, že nemůžeme použít čísla 2 nebo 3, která ve dvojkové soustavě nejsou. Poradíme si následujícím způsobem (také obdobným postupu v desítkové soustavě):
Mějme sčítance a a b, součet s, a přenos do vyššího řádu c.
V nejnižším řádu je pro ai + bi = 1 + 1 součet si = 0 a přenos (přičtení) do vyššího řádu ci+1 = 1.
Ve vyšších řádech je například pro ai + bi + ci = 1 + 1 + 1 součet si = 1 a přenos do vyššího řádu ci+1 = 1.
Z důvodu dlouhých řad číslic a velkého množství přenosů je sčítání obtížné a snadno se udělá chyba. Naštěstí je to jedno, protože je za nás provádí číslicové obvody, které v předmětu číslicová technika studujeme.
Sčítačku dvou čtyřbitových čísel A a B můžeme sestavit z jednobitových sčítaček a jedné poloviční sčítačky následujícím způsobem:
Jednotlivé řády sčítají jednobitové sčítačky, které sčítají oba operandy plus přenos z nižšího řádu. Výstupními funkcemi jsou součet a přenos do vyššího řádu. Nejnižší řád přenos z nižšího řádu nepřičítá, a vystačí proto s jednodušší -poloviční sčítačkou.
Pravdivostní tabulka poloviční sčítačky
Navrhněte a nakreslete schéma poloviční sčítačky.
Pravdivostní tabulka úplné sčítačky
Navrhněte a nakreslete schéma úplné sčítačky
-značka podle IEC
Odečítání se převádí na sčítání pomocí doplňků. Doplněk menšitele vytvoříme tak, že zaměníme 1 za 0 a naopak. Součtem menšence s doplňkem menšitele získáme mezivýsledek, který sečteme s přenosem vzniklým přetečením rozsahu původního počtu bitů. Výsledný součet je hledaný rozdíl.
Příklad: 11 - 9 = 2